Dana Scully shifted her very pregnant body in the uncomfortable chair that had been designated "hers" down in the basement office. Her maternity leave had officially begun three weeks before, but since Mulder returned to work, she was charged with keeping the peace between Mulder and Doggett. Mulder refused to work closely with Agent Doggett and instead worked with Scully. If you could call the few words he said to her at the office working with her.

Out of her own fears for Mulder's safety, Scully had asked him to stay with her until she thought he had recovered enough. Mulder stayed all right, he stayed in one place on the couch only moving when it was time for work, food, or to sleep, then he'd lie down.

Scully was damn frustrated. She wanted Mulder to feel like he could talk to her about what he'd been through. She wasn't used to the changes in his personality. Where he'd once been sarcastically witty and charming, he used his sarcasm to hurt people, Scully most of all.

She was afraid that her pregnancy was putting the strain on her relationship with Mulder. She knew he was feeling out of sorts already and having his partner seven months pregnant didn't help. Scully hoped that Mulder didn't think she'd been unfaithful to him in the months that he was gone. Even though they'd never verbally expressed the fact that there wouldn't be anyone else, Scully thought that Mulder knew he was the only one.

Scully thought about telling Mulder that the baby was his, if only to try to brighten his mood. After she considered the possibilities however, Scully wondered if Mulder was acting the way he was because he knew that the baby was his and he didn't want it. After all, the first time they'd made love, Scully had assured him of the improbability of her getting pregnant. Mulder had shushed her like he didn't care, but she still thought that that might be the reason.

Brought back to the present by a powerful kick from within, Scully ran her hand over her abdomen and looked at the clock. Seeing that she and Mulder had gotten a sufficient amount of work in, Scully stacked her papers and pushed herself out of her chair.

"Need any help Agent Scully?" Doggett asked from his desk.

"No, I'm okay. Thank you Agent Doggett." Scully smiled softly but refused Doggett's offer. Mulder would shoot him venomous looks each time he approached her. "Mulder are you ready to go."

"No." Mulder snapped and Scully was taken aback by the harshness of his voice. "Sorry, give me a minute or two okay?" Mulder amended smiling slightly at Scully who forgave him immediately even though she knew she should be hurt by his actions.

Scully knew that Mulder didn't mind much physical contact as long as her belly didn't touch him, so she waddled over to his desk and stood behind him, rubbing his back in the absentminded way he used to love. She felt Mulder tense and lean farther over his work.

Mulder stood and let Scully's hand fall from his back. He spun around, nearly knocking her over. "Sorry Scully. I'll be ready to go as soon as I take this up to Skinman."

"Alright, hurry. Someone is doing somersaults and my back is killing me because of it." Scully was lowering herself back down into Mulder's chair and didn't see Mulder's scowl.

"He's not worth it Agent Scully." Doggett rumbled. Scully's head shot to Doggett.

"Excuse me Agent Doggett?"

"He's not worth it. You're putting your health and your child's health at risk for…" Doggett trailed off as Mulder reentered the room. Mulder glanced at Doggett and turned to Scully. He held out his hands to pull her from the chair. Scully grasped them warmly and together they hefted her out of the chair. Mulder immediately dropped her hands and grabbed his notes.

He'll find any excuse not to touch me Scully thought sadly.

Mulder grunted a goodbye to Doggett and walked out ahead of Scully to her car.
